OVERVIEW:

FULL NAME:
Charles Warren Fairbanks

BORN:
May 11, 1852;
Unionville Center, Ohio

DIED:
June 4, 1918 (age 66);
Indianapolis, Indiana

EDUCATION:
Ohio Wesleyan University (BA, MA)

POLITICAL PARTY:
Republican

HIGHLIGHTS:
1874:
Admitted to the Ohio Bar,
Moved to Indianapolis. Indiana 
1893:
Unsuccessful Candidate for Election to the U.S. Senate 
1897-1905:
U.S. Senator (R-IN)
1905-1909:
Vice President of the United States
1916:
Unsuccessful Candidate for Vice President on the Republican ticket with Charles E. Hughes,
Resumed Practice of Law in Indianapolis, Indiana
